Residential Waterproofing in Tuscaloosa, AL
Residential waterproofing services focus on protecting homes from water intrusion and moisture-related issues. This service typically covers projects such as basement waterproofing, foundation sealing, crawl space encapsulation, and exterior drainage improvements. Property owners often seek waterproofing to prevent leaks, reduce mold growth, and maintain the structural integrity of their homes. Understanding the specific areas vulnerable to water damage and the types of waterproofing solutions available can help homeowners make informed decisions before requesting service.
Before requesting residential waterproofing, property owners usually want to know about the condition of their foundation and basement, as well as any signs of water intrusion like dampness, mold, or cracks. It's also common to inquire about the different waterproofing methods suitable for their home's design and local climate. Clarifying the scope of work, potential disruptions, and maintenance requirements can ensure homeowners are prepared for the process and can maintain the effectiveness of the waterproofing system over time.

Common Residential Waterproofing Jobs
Foundation Waterproofing - prevents water infiltration that can cause foundation damage and structural issues.
Basement Waterproofing - keeps basements dry and protects belongings from water damage.
Crawl Space Waterproofing - reduces moisture and prevents mold growth under the home.
Exterior Waterproofing - applies barriers to walls to stop water from seeping into the property.
Interior Waterproofing - installs drainage systems and sealants inside to manage leaks effectively.
Leak Repair - addresses existing leaks to prevent further water damage and maintain home integrity.
Residential Waterproofing Questions
What areas do residential waterproofing services cover? These services typically include basements, crawl spaces, foundations, and other vulnerable areas around a home to prevent water intrusion and damage.
What types of waterproofing methods are available? Common options include interior sealants, exterior membranes, drainage systems, and sump pump installations to manage water effectively.
How can waterproofing help protect a property? Proper waterproofing reduces the risk of structural damage, mold growth, and interior water issues, helping to maintain a safe and dry living environment.
What signs indicate a need for waterproofing? Signs include persistent dampness, water stains on walls or floors, musty odors, or visible cracks in the foundation or basement walls.
